Summary: "Charles and Lizzie Peterson love puppies. Their family fosters these young dogs, giving them love and proper care, until they can find the perfect forever home. Charles is determined to help Moose, a giant Great Dane puppy. The problem is that this huge pup is scared of everything - loud noises, other dogs, even his own shadow!"--P. [4] cover.

Summary: One day, Ruth and her mom are in the park and see a pet adoption fair. Ruth is drawn to a cute little dog, but they are moving soon and can't adopt. However, they can foster for a couple of months, and that's how they wind up with Ginger. Then Daisy. Then Cody, a special-needs dog with injured hind legs. Can Ruth help Cody find his forever home?
